Synopsis "The Call of Uwyn"

"Stephanie Letourneau's delicate touch makes Caihrn, its strange creatures and ongoing adventures come to life in a novel that will leave you smiling and wishing for more." -Bill Schweitzer, author of Doves in a Tempest: Valley of HorrorsAfter a dead-end job and a broken relationship bring her down, Sawyer is ready for something new.When she discovers a mysterious box in her home, she unwittingly embarks on an adventure to another planet, where she must learn a new way of life full of wonder and magic.Just as she is feeling at home, dark forces threaten her adopted planet, and she and her new friends must rise up to defend themselves and the planet they have come to love.Written by debut author Stephanie Letourneau, The Call of Uwyn is a new-adult fantasy novel about finding your place and learning to see the magic in the world.
